[arch-commits] Commit in llvm/trunk (PKGBUILD)

Evangelos Foutras foutrelis at archlinux.org
Wed Sep 16 18:42:13 UTC 2015


    Date: Wednesday, September 16, 2015 @ 20:42:13
  Author: foutrelis
Revision: 246407

upgpkg: llvm 3.7.0-1

New upstream release.

Modified:
  llvm/trunk/PKGBUILD

----------+
 PKGBUILD |    7 ++++++-
 1 file changed, 6 insertions(+), 1 deletion(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2015-09-16 17:51:15 UTC (rev 246406)
+++ PKGBUILD	2015-09-16 18:42:13 UTC (rev 246407)
@@ -12,7 +12,7 @@
 pkgname=('llvm' 'llvm-libs' 'llvm-ocaml' 'lldb' 'clang' 'clang-analyzer'
          'clang-tools-extra')
 pkgver=3.7.0
-pkgrel=0
+pkgrel=1
 _ocaml_ver=4.02.3
 arch=('i686' 'x86_64')
 url="http://llvm.org/"
@@ -57,6 +57,11 @@
 
   mv "$srcdir/lldb-$pkgver.src" tools/lldb
 
+  # Fix compiler-rt build on i686
+  # https://llvm.org/bugs/show_bug.cgi?id=22661
+  sed -i '/ifeq.*CompilerTargetArch/s/i386/i686/g' \
+    projects/compiler-rt/make/platform/clang_linux.mk
+
   # Fix docs installation directory
   sed -i 's:$(PROJ_prefix)/docs/llvm:$(PROJ_prefix)/share/doc/llvm:' \
     Makefile.config.in



More information about the arch-commits mailing list